EBAY vs. CSCO
EBAY (eBay Inc.) and CSCO (Cisco Systems, Inc.) are both stocks. EBAY operates in Internet Retail (Consumer Cyclical), while CSCO operates in Communication Equipment (Technology). Over the past 10 years, EBAY returned 17.79%/yr vs 18.92%/yr for CSCO. At a 0.43 correlation, their price movements are largely independent.

EBAY vs. CSCO - Profitability Comparison
EBAY -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, eBay Inc. reported a gross profit of 2.29B and revenue of 3.09B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 74.0%.
CSCO -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Cisco Systems, Inc. reported a gross profit of 10.08B and revenue of 15.84B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 63.6%.
EBAY -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, eBay Inc. reported an operating income of 611.00M and revenue of 3.09B, resulting in an operating margin of 19.8%.
CSCO -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Cisco Systems, Inc. reported an operating income of 3.96B and revenue of 15.84B, resulting in an operating margin of 25.0%.
EBAY -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, eBay Inc. reported a net income of 512.00M and revenue of 3.09B, resulting in a net margin of 16.6%.
CSCO -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Cisco Systems, Inc. reported a net income of 3.37B and revenue of 15.84B, resulting in a net margin of 21.3%.
